DNS劫持及应对措施如何预防和应对DNS劫持攻击

时间:2025-12-07 分类:网络技术

DNS劫持是一种网络攻击方式,它通过篡改域名系统(DNS)的解析过程,将用户的请求引导至恶意网站,窃取信息或传播恶意软件。近年来,随着互联网的发展,这类攻击愈发频繁,因此了解DNS劫持的基本原理和应对措施显得至关重要。

DNS劫持及应对措施如何预防和应对DNS劫持攻击

在了解DNS劫持之前,可以看看DNS的基本功能。DNS负责将用户友好的域名(如www.example.com)转换为计算机可识别的IP地址。攻击者通过对DNS请求进行干预,能够将用户指向一个伪装的网站,而用户对此毫无察觉。预防和应对DNS劫持成为网络安全领域的重要 tasks。

预防DNS劫持的第一步是使用可信赖的DNS服务。许多依赖公共DNS的用户选择Google DNS、OpenDNS等,这些服务提供商通常具备更强的安全措施,能有效抵御基础的DNS劫持攻击。使用DNSSEC可以数位签署DNS数据,以确保请求的数据未被篡改,从而提升安全性。

另一种有效的防范措施是定期检查网络设置。确保路由器和计算机的DNS设置未被修改为可疑的IP地址。如果发现不明的DNS地址,应及时将其更改为信任的DNS服务器。定期更新路由器的固件,以确保Bug修复和最新的安全补丁已被应用。启用路由器的防火墙功能,能够增加一个额外的保护层,帮助防范恶意请求。

在应对DNS劫持攻击后,快速反应是关键。为了识别潜在的攻击,建议定期监控访问日志,查看是否有异常的DNS请求或浏览行为。还可以考虑使用入侵检测系统(IDS),这些系统可以实时监控网络活动并及时发出警报。

用户也应保持良好的网络安全意识。在访问网站时,务必留意网址的正确性,特别是在输入敏感信息之前。使用HTTPS协议的网站相对更安全,它可以加密用户和网站之间的通信,降低信息被泄露的风险。

在遇到DNS劫持问题时,恢复操作非常重要。用户应了解如何清除本地DNS缓存,可以通过在命令行中输入适当的命令(如ipconfig /flushdns)来实现。这一操作有助于消除被篡改的DNS信息,使设备能够重新获取新的、正确的DNS地址。

提升网络安全知识同样重要。定期参加网络安全培训或在线课程,了解最新的攻击方式及防范措施,有助于增强自身以及团队的防护能力。

常见问题解答(FAQ)

1. 什么是DNS劫持?

DNS劫持是一种网络攻击,攻击者通过篡改DNS解析过程,将用户引导至恶意网站。

2. 如何检查我的DNS设置是否安全?

登录路由器管理界面,检查DNS设置项,确保其指向信誉良好的DNS服务器。

3. DNSSEC是什么,如何使用?

DNSSEC是一种安全扩展技术,通过对DNS数据进行数字签名,确保数据未被篡改。具体使用可咨询DNS服务提供商。

4. 遇到DNS劫持后应该如何处理?

及时检查并修复DNS设置,并清除本地DNS缓存,确保设备重新获取正确的DNS信息。

5. 使用公共DNS服务安全吗?

一般而言,知名的公共DNS服务如Google DNS和OpenDNS提供更强的安全性和可靠性,但还是需定期检查和更新网络安全设置。